1.1. Travel Nurse
Do you want to leverage your healthcare skills while exploring new places? Travel nursing allows you to choose your job locations and healthcare settings, often without needing additional licensing.

As a travel nurse, you can apply your nursing skills in various locations. Travel nurses provide the same services as staff nurses but can often earn more, with a median salary of around $111,195 per year, according to Glassdoor. If you’re looking to explore different healthcare environments while advancing your career, travel nursing might be the perfect fit.
1.2. Management Analyst
Are you skilled at improving business performance? Management analysts, or business consultants, often travel to meet with management teams at struggling businesses.
With a median salary of $95,290 per year, according to the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S), this role involves jet-setting to different cities to assist companies in need. Your expertise can drive significant improvements and offer new perspectives to various organizations.
1.3. Foreign Service Worker
Do you want to serve your country abroad? Foreign service workers represent the U.S. government at embassies worldwide, addressing various issues and connecting with different cultures.
These positions may require working in challenging areas, sometimes without family. Responsibilities can range from assisting with lost passports to preparing business opportunity reports. Glassdoor reports a median salary of $92,513, depending on the location.
1.4. Blogger
Do you have a passion for writing and sharing your experiences? As a blogger, you can write about your interests, whether on a personal blog or for clients.
Travel blogging, in particular, allows you to share your experiences, recommend hotels, and highlight hotspots. The average writer earns a median of about $73,150 per year, according to the BLS. 1.5. Train Conductor
Are you fascinated by trains and travel? Train conductors operate and coordinate trains, ensuring they run smoothly and on schedule.
This job involves constant motion and is ideal for those who enjoy visiting new places. Although it requires extensive training and certification, the travel opportunities in Europe, for example, are well worth the commitment. The BLS reports that most railroad workers receive a median salary of $68,960.
1.6. Flight Attendant
Do you enjoy flying and interacting with people? As a flight attendant, you’ll spend much of your time in the air, visiting different cities and countries.
With a median salary of around $63,760, according to the BLS, this job involves ensuring the safety and comfort of passengers. It requires stringent interviews and extensive training but offers flexible schedules and the opportunity to meet diverse people.
1.7. Training Specialist
Are you passionate about coaching and professional development? Training specialists travel to work with various businesses, providing coaching and professional development opportunities to employees.
With a median annual salary of $63,080, according to the BLS, this role allows you to help people upskill and grow professionally while exploring new places. If you have a background in education, this could be an ideal career.
1.8. Truck Driver
Do you prefer solitude on the open road? Truck drivers are responsible for transporting goods from one place to another, often within the U.S., but sometimes to Canada or Mexico.
Drivers can earn a median wage of $53,090 per year, depending on experience and track record, according to the BLS. This job requires a commercial driver’s license but not necessarily a college degree, making it accessible for many.
1.9. Event Planner
Are you skilled at organizing and strategizing? Event planners coordinate various events, from weddings to international galas.
Working freelance allows you to plan events from anywhere in the world. The median salary for this position is around $52,560, according to the BLS, but experienced planners can set higher freelance rates.
1.10. Travel Technician
Do you enjoy working with your hands and solving technical issues? Travel technicians install and maintain equipment for various workplaces, like tech and manufacturing companies.
Visiting different sites around the city or country offers a change of scenery. The median salary for a travel technician is $52,240 per year, though it depends on the equipment you work with.
1.11. TEFL or ESL Teacher
Do you want to teach English abroad? As a TEFL (Teaching English as a Foreign Language) or ESL (English as a Second Language) teacher, you can work with people of all ages in different countries.
This role requires training and certification, with the TEFL organization offering various courses. You can earn a median salary of $50,140, depending on the location, while living long-term in a foreign country.
1.12. International Aid Worker
Are you committed to helping others in need? International aid workers provide assistance to people in foreign countries, often in areas like healthcare and education.
Although the median salary of $47,173 is lower than other jobs on this list, according to Glassdoor, this role offers a chance to make a real difference in the world. A background in medicine, education, or agriculture can be beneficial but isn’t always necessary.
1.13. Cruise Ship Chef
Do you love cooking and traveling? Being a cruise ship chef involves preparing meals for staff and guests while traveling to different countries.
The average salary for a chef on a popular line like Royal Caribbean is about $44,942 per year, but this includes room and board. Culinary education is often required for this role.
1.14. Au Pair
Are you interested in childcare and cultural exchange? Being an au pair in a foreign country involves caring for children in exchange for a salary and room and board.
The median salary is $38,838, according to Glassdoor, but living expenses are covered. This is a great opportunity for cultural immersion and offers a unique benefit if you want to spend a year or two abroad.
1.15. Traveling Photographer
Do you have an artistic eye and a love for travel? As a traveling photographer, you’ll capture events or landscapes in different locations.
The median salary for photographers is $40,170, according to the BLS, but this varies depending on whether you work for an employer or freelance. You can also earn a living by publishing your photos online and through social media.
